okay, here is my question, i have a 1995 GT that has just gotten to the 75,000 mile mark, i changed the oil at 72,000 and used Mobil 1(10w-30) Synthetic, the question is, should i change to a different oil for high mileage engines, or am i safe sticking to Mobil 1 synthetic? What suggestion do you have on the kind of oil i should use. Any help you can give me will be much apreciated. Thanks.

I wouldnt bother switching if I were you. As long as you change oil and filter every 3,000 and use a street oil(like 10w-30 vs. say 20w50), you'll be fine. I never change oil grade with mileage and have never had a problem.

I think synthetic's are the biggest waste of money. I use conventional 10w-40 and change my oil every 2800-3000, no questions asked. As long as you do regular oil changes, conventional will be all you need.

Synthetics do stand up to thermal breakdown better but it gets dirty just like regular oil from normal use. It will be just as dirty as regular oil at 3,000 miles. Save the money and just change the oil regularly like you should.
